Young Heroes Referral Criteria

 

Until there are cures for enemies like childhood cancer, cystic fibrosis, leukemia, and heart disease, the greatest weapon in the arsenal of these remarkable children will continue to be courage--the kind of courage that deserves a hero's medal.

 

Recipients of the Young Heroes Medal of Honor range in age from 2 to 17. Anyone who knows the child and can verify that the youngster has, indeed, faced or is facing a life-threatening illness or injury can make a referral. The award is primarily for those who have struggled through surgery, chemotherapy, radiation treatments, physical therapy, or other similar types of treatment. As a result, children just recently diagnosed are not typical recipients. On occasion, a child has been awarded the Young Heroes Medal of Honor when a social worker or physician feels the child might be losing hope in their struggle.
